Key Features
- Ease of Printing: UltiMaker PET CF is easier to print than most composite materials, making it accessible for users of all skill levels.
- Moisture Resistance: This material is more moisture-resistant than many other composites, ensuring it remains dry and ready for use.
- Colour Options: Available in multiple colours, including black, blue, and gray, allowing for versatile design choices.
- Support Material Compatibility: Compatible with UltiMaker support materials such as PVA and Breakaway, providing full geometric freedom in your designs.
- Enhanced Properties Through Annealing: Annealing can improve the temperature resistance of your printed parts from 80°C to an impressive 181°C. Additionally, annealing increases the strength by 30% and stiffness by 10%. The recommended and validated BINDER FP115 programmable oven is ideal for this process.

Specifications
- Diameter: 2.85 mm
- Max. Roundness Deviation: 0.1 mm
- Net Filament Weight: 750 g
- Filament Length: Approximately 85 m
